O que é Análise de Bots?
A análise de bots é uma prática essencial para qualquer empresa que deseja entender e combater a presença de bots em seu ambiente online. Os bots, também conhecidos como robôs, são programas de computador que executam tarefas automatizadas na internet. Embora existam bots legítimos, como os utilizados por mecanismos de busca para indexar páginas da web, também há bots maliciosos que podem causar danos significativos.
Como os Bots Funcionam?
Os bots podem ser programados para realizar uma ampla variedade de tarefas na internet. Alguns exemplos comuns incluem:
– Web scraping: os bots podem ser usados para coletar informações de sites, como preços de produtos ou dados de contato;
– Spam: bots podem enviar mensagens indesejadas em fóruns, redes sociais e caixas de entrada de e-mails;
– Ataques DDoS: bots podem ser usados para sobrecarregar um servidor com tráfego falso, tornando-o inacessível para usuários legítimos;
– Fraude publicitária: bots podem clicar em anúncios online para gerar receita fraudulenta para os responsáveis pelos bots;
– Manipulação de redes sociais: bots podem ser usados para aumentar artificialmente o número de seguidores, curtidas e compartilhamentos em plataformas como o Instagram e o Twitter.
Por que a Análise de Bots é Importante?
A presença de bots maliciosos pode ter um impacto significativo nos negócios online. Além de causar prejuízos financeiros, os bots podem comprometer a integridade dos dados, afetar a experiência do usuário e prejudicar a reputação da empresa. Portanto, é essencial realizar uma análise de bots para identificar e mitigar possíveis ameaças.
Como Realizar a Análise de Bots?
A análise de bots envolve a coleta e o processamento de dados para identificar padrões e comportamentos suspeitos. Existem várias técnicas e ferramentas disponíveis para realizar essa análise, incluindo:
– Monitoramento de tráfego: analisar o tráfego de entrada em um site pode ajudar a identificar atividades suspeitas, como um alto número de solicitações em um curto período de tempo;
– Análise de padrões: identificar padrões de comportamento, como horários de acesso ou sequências de cliques, pode ajudar a distinguir bots de usuários legítimos;
– Análise de user-agent: os bots geralmente têm user-agents específicos, que podem ser identificados e bloqueados;
– Uso de captchas: a utilização de captchas pode ajudar a distinguir bots de usuários reais, já que os bots geralmente têm dificuldade em resolver esses desafios;
– Utilização de serviços de detecção de bots: existem várias empresas especializadas em detectar e bloquear bots maliciosos, oferecendo soluções eficazes para proteger um site.
Benefícios da Análise de Bots
A análise de bots traz uma série de benefícios para as empresas, incluindo:
– Proteção contra fraudes: identificar e bloquear bots maliciosos ajuda a prevenir fraudes, como cliques fraudulentos em anúncios;
– Melhoria da experiência do usuário: ao eliminar bots que sobrecarregam servidores ou enviam spam, a experiência do usuário melhora significativamente;
– Proteção de dados: bots maliciosos podem ser usados para roubar informações sensíveis, como dados de cartões de crédito. A análise de bots ajuda a proteger essas informações;
– Melhoria do SEO: ao eliminar bots que afetam negativamente o tráfego e a classificação de um site, a análise de bots contribui para um melhor desempenho nos mecanismos de busca;
– Economia de recursos: ao identificar e bloquear bots, as empresas economizam recursos, como largura de banda e capacidade de processamento.
Conclusão
A análise de bots é uma prática fundamental para proteger a integridade dos negócios online. Ao identificar e bloquear bots maliciosos, as empresas podem prevenir fraudes, melhorar a experiência do usuário, proteger dados sensíveis e otimizar o desempenho nos mecanismos de busca. Portanto, é essencial investir em técnicas e ferramentas de análise de bots para garantir a segurança e o sucesso de um negócio na internet.